Hamburg, Germany – American guard Devon Daniels has joined Veolia Towers Hamburg for the remainder of the 2025-26 season, the club announced on February 11, 2026. The signing aims to bolster the team’s backcourt as they compete in the BKT EuroCup and the easyCredit BBL.

Daniels, 27, arrives from Lithuania and is expected to bring scoring power to the Hamburg offense. He is anticipated to arrive in Hamburg later this week and will undergo medical checks before joining team practices, according to club statements. He could witness playing time as early as next week.

“We have intensively searched for reinforcements on the guard positions and have found the right player in Devon,” said Head Coach Benka Barloschky. “He plays with a lot of calm and is simultaneously dangerous. He can create his own shot and also play off the ball.”

Daniels’ path to Hamburg has included stops in Serbia, Poland, and Greece as he adapted his game to the European style of basketball. Prior to his European career, Daniels faced challenges following a knee injury sustained during his time at North Carolina State University, which interrupted his college career after a promising start at the University of Utah alongside NBA champion Kyle Kuzma. He also spent time in the G-League attempting to establish himself.

The Veolia Towers Hamburg recently secured an upset victory on the road against the Skyliners Frankfurt, with Daniels contributing significantly to the 82-78 win. Daniels emphasized the team’s ability to manage Frankfurt’s runs and maintain composure, stating, “We did a excellent job handling the runs of Frankfurt. We only had problems when we didn’t have pace and when we weren’t able to control the defensive rebound.”

The addition of Daniels comes as Veolia Towers Hamburg currently holds a 4-10 record in the German easyCredit BBL. The team is 0-7 in Group A of the BKT EuroCup Regular Season, tied with three other teams at the bottom of the standings. The top two teams from each group will advance directly to the Quarterfinals, with the next four earning a spot in the Eighthfinals.
